- Title Note: Victor ledgers: "Alma mater" to tune of 'Maryland. my Maryland."
| Notes |
|---|
| Victor ledgers show composition of chorus as 10 first tenors, 12 second tenors, 12 first basses, and 12 second basses. |
| Ledgers: "Mr. Fred Erdman, present." |
